What Defines a Top Rated Free Bingo Site in 2026

Bingo in the UK is dominated by three formats. 90-ball is the classic: three rows and nine columns per ticket, with three chances to win on any game (one line, two lines, or a full house). 75-ball uses a five-by-five grid and tends to be faster, with patterns dictating the win conditions. 80-ball is a modern compromise — a four-by-four grid, quicker rounds, and a middle ground for players who find 90-ball too slow and 75-ball too frantic.

The free bingo landscape in 2026 is shaped by ticket prices rather than the headline bonus numbers you see on casino slots. A typical paid room charges anywhere from 1p to 10p per ticket, with premium rooms and jackpot games pushing that higher. Free tickets are usually valued at the low end of that scale — commonly 5p or 10p per ticket — and that is precisely where players misunderstand the value. A “£10 free bingo” offer does not put £10 in your wallet; it credits your bingo account with tickets whose total face value is £10. You then play those tickets in live rooms, and any winnings become withdrawable cash once you meet the site’s terms.

That distinction matters more than any other single fact in this guide. Free bingo is a promotional credit for playing, not a cash bonus. The best sites make this clear in their terms; the worst bury it in small print. Every operator in the table below is UKGC-licensed, which means the terms must be published and the free tickets must behave as described.

How Welcome Structures Work in Bingo, Not Casino

Casino welcome offers revolve around deposit matches and free spins. Bingo welcome offers work differently because the product is different. A bingo room has a schedule of games running from morning to night, and the operator wants you to sit in those rooms, chat, and play repeatedly. So the welcome structure typically bundles three things: a deposit match on your first deposit, a set of free tickets for specific rooms, and often a chat-based reward for your first day of play.

Take the free tickets element first. A typical new-player offer might credit you with tickets worth £5 to £10 across a selection of rooms — often the 90-ball room at set times, sometimes a mix of 75 and 80-ball games. You do not choose which games the free tickets apply to; the operator allocates them. That is not a flaw; it is how the room manages its schedule, ensuring new players populate the games that need numbers.

The deposit match, where it exists, is usually expressed as a percentage of your first deposit, but it is frequently paid in bingo tickets rather than cash. A 100% match on a £10 deposit might return £10 in ticket credit, not £10 in your cash balance. You can see the distinction immediately in the site’s balance screen: cash, bonus, and tickets are tracked separately.

Wagering requirements on bingo tickets behave differently from casino bonuses. Where a casino bonus might demand you wager the bonus 35x on slots, bingo sites typically require you to play through the free ticket value a set number of times — commonly between 20x and 65x — across eligible bingo games or, in some cases, selected slots and side games. The multiplier applies to the ticket credit, not to your deposit. So a £10 free ticket credit at 35x requires £350 of qualifying bingo play before the winnings become withdrawable. Always check whether side games count toward the wagering, because most sites weight bingo at 100% but slots at a fraction of that.

Community Features: Chat Games, Moderators, and Side Games

Bingo’s defining advantage over slots is the chat room. A good chat room transforms a solitary game into a social one, and the best operators invest heavily in this. Chat games are mini-competitions run by the room’s host: answer a question correctly, spot a repeated number, or be the first to greet a new player, and you win a small ticket credit or a few bonus points. These are not life-changing sums, but they extend your play session and, over a week of regular play, they add up to a meaningful number of free tickets.

Moderators, or “hosts” as they are usually called in UK bingo, are the difference between a welcoming room and a hostile one. The top sites employ full-time hosts who run the chat games, keep the conversation civil, and — crucially — explain the rules to newcomers. If a host is absent or robotic, the room dies. When you evaluate a free bingo offer, the quality of the chat is part of the value equation, because a lively room means more chat games, which means more free tickets.

Side games are the casino products bolted onto the bingo lobby — slots, instant-win games, and sometimes live dealer tables. They matter for one reason: they are often the only way to meet the wagering requirement on your free ticket credit quickly. A £10 ticket credit at 35x needs £350 of play, and playing that entirely through 5p bingo tickets is a slow grind. Many players use slots to clear the requirement faster, since slots spin in seconds. Just remember that slots carry a higher house edge than bingo, so you are spending value to clear value. Budgeting: Ticket Strategy, Session Pacing, and Prize Types

Free bingo is not a licence to ignore budgeting — it is an invitation to be more deliberate about it. When you have free tickets in your account, the temptation is to play them all in one sitting. That is almost always the wrong move, because bingo prizes are distributed across a session, not concentrated in a single game. Spreading your free tickets across multiple games over a few days gives you more chances to land a line or a full house, and it keeps you in the chat room long enough to accumulate chat-game winnings.

Prize structures vary by game type. A standard 90-ball game pays for one line, two lines, and a full house, with the full house taking the largest share of the prize pool. Jackpot games set aside a portion of each ticket sale into a rolling pot that can grow to four or five figures; these are the games where a 5p ticket can return a genuinely large win. But jackpot games have more players, which means your free ticket faces stiffer competition. A quieter 75-ball room with a modest prize pool may actually be better value for a free ticket, because your odds of winning any prize are higher.

Session pacing is about the rhythm of your play. The top rated sites run games on a fixed schedule, so you can plan around them. Decide in advance how many games you will play per session, and stop when you reach that number. Free tickets are an entertainment credit, not an obligation. If you have £10 of free ticket value and you lose it across ten games without a win, that is the expected outcome roughly half the time; the value is in the play itself, not the guaranteed return.

Mobile Experience and the Software Behind the Rooms

Bingo is a mobile-first format in the UK, and the top rated sites reflect that. The best apps let you buy tickets with one tap, auto-daub numbers without lag, and switch between the bingo room and the chat without reloading the page. Foxy Bingo and Bet UK Casino both handle this well, with native apps for iOS and Android that feel faster than the browser versions. Coral’s app is slightly more basic but remains stable on older devices, which is a real consideration if your phone is a few years old.

The software providers behind the rooms determine the game feel. Most UK bingo sites run on platforms from a small number of established suppliers, and the differences are visible: some platforms render the numbers with a satisfying animation, others are purely functional; some handle the chat reliably at high volume, others stutter when the room fills up. You cannot choose the provider directly, but you can test it — every site in the table above offers some form of free or low-cost play, so you can judge the software before depositing.

Mobile also affects how you use free tickets. Some sites restrict free tickets to desktop play, while others allow them on any device. The terms will state this explicitly, but it is worth checking before you accept an offer, because a free ticket you cannot use on your phone is worth nothing if you never play on a computer. Banking for Bingo: Deposits, Withdrawal Speed, and Minimum Cashouts

Deposits at UK bingo sites are straightforward: debit cards, e-wallets like PayPal and Skrill, and prepaid options are standard. Credit cards have been banned for gambling in Great Britain since April 2020, so you cannot use them here. E-wallets are the fastest route to a withdrawal, because the funds return to the same account you deposited from, without the bank verification step that card withdrawals sometimes trigger.

Withdrawal speed is where bingo sites differ most from casinos. A well-run bingo site processes withdrawals within 24 hours on weekdays; a poorly run one can take several days. The practical terms table below shows what you can reasonably expect, but note that first withdrawals often take longer because the operator must verify your identity under UKGC rules. Get your ID checks done early — upload your documents when you register, not when you try to cash out.

Term Typical Value What It Means for You
Free ticket condition Must be used within 7–14 days of issue Unused free tickets expire; play them or lose them
Wagering on free ticket winnings 20x – 65x on the ticket credit Winnings are locked until you meet the playthrough
Minimum withdrawal £5 – £100 Below this, the site will not process a cashout
Withdrawal time (e-wallet) Within 24 hours once approved Fastest route; bank transfers take 2–5 working days
Verification 24–48 hours for first withdrawal Upload ID and proof of address at registration

These are typical commercial terms, not legal requirements. Every operator sets its own figures, and they change frequently, so check the current terms before you rely on a specific number. Step-by-Step: How a Free Ticket Offer Resolves

Understanding the lifecycle of a free ticket offer removes most of the confusion. The process below is typical of the top rated sites in 2026; the exact values differ by operator, but the sequence is consistent.

Step Action Outcome
1 Register and verify your identity Your account is activated and eligible for offers
2 Accept the free ticket offer from the promotions page Tickets appear in your bingo account, not your cash balance
3 Check which rooms and times the tickets apply to You know exactly where to play and when
4 Play the tickets in the designated rooms Winnings accumulate as a separate balance
5 Meet the wagering requirement on the ticket credit The winnings unlock and move to your cash balance
6 Request a withdrawal once you exceed the minimum cashout Funds return via your original deposit method

The critical step is number five. If the wagering requirement is 35x on a £10 ticket credit, you must generate £350 of qualifying play before any winnings are yours. That figure is the product of the credit and the multiplier, and it is the single biggest factor in whether a “free” offer is actually worth your time.

Before You Play: Responsible Gambling in Plain Terms

Free bingo is entertainment, and it should be treated as such. Every site in this guide is 18+ and licensed by the UK Gambling Commission, which means the games are independently tested and the operators must offer you tools to control your play. Set a deposit limit before you start, use the session timers that alert you to how long you have been playing, and if you ever feel the habit is becoming a problem, the free support services are there for you. GambleAware provides confidential advice at BeGambleAware.org, and GAMSTOP — the free national self-exclusion scheme at gamstop.co.uk — lets you block yourself from all UKGC-licensed sites in one go. The house edge means the operator wins over time; treat every session as a cost of entertainment, never as a way to make money.

Reader Questions on Free Bingo

What happens if I do not use my free tickets before they expire?

The tickets simply vanish from your account. Most operators give you between seven and fourteen days from the moment the offer is credited, and the expiry date is shown in your promotions or bingo ticket balance. Set a reminder or play them within the first few days; there is no way to extend the window, and the operator will not reinstate expired tickets.

Do free bingo tickets ever pay out as real cash without wagering?

Almost never. Nearly every free ticket offer attaches a wagering requirement — typically between 20x and 65x on the ticket credit — before winnings become withdrawable. The rare exceptions are no-wagering promotions, which you will see labelled explicitly as such. If the terms do not mention wagering, assume it applies and read the small print to confirm.

Should I prioritise a big welcome bundle or a faster withdrawal time?

That depends on your style. If you play regularly and value getting your winnings promptly, choose the site with the fastest verified payouts, even if its welcome offer is smaller. If you are a casual player trying a room for the first time, a larger free ticket bundle gives you more games to judge the experience. In both cases, check the wagering terms first — a generous bundle with a 65x requirement can be worse value than a modest one at 20x.
